Why oh why can’t we put an Oz team together... surely our resources industry had almost got enough dosh? One of the fastest growing regattas in Australia cranks into action over the weekend. With feeder races from Pittwater and Newcastle Sail Port Stephens 2012 will be bigger than ever. There will be 50 boats in the Commodore Cup fleet through to Wednesday then 30 boat IRC fleet, with a RP63 and four TP52’s will be worth talking about and don’t be surprised if this is the hottest Performance Racing Division 1 fleet in Australian sailing history. Talked this afternoon to Jim Walsh from the Elliot 7 fleet – the class is very excited about the quality and size of the fleet, looks like 14 boats with some very well known names.
